We’re getting a first look at Scarpetta, Prime Video‘s new forensic crime thriller based on Patricia Cornwell’s bestselling Kay Scarpetta book series, starring Nicole Kidman in the title role. The streamer has released several first-look photos which you can see above and below.
Kidman stars as Dr. Kay Scarpetta, an unrelenting medical examiner, who with skilled hands and an unnerving eye is determined to serve as the voice of the victims, unmask a serial killer, and prove that her career-making case from 28 years prior isn’t also her undoing. Set against the backdrop of modern forensic investigation, the series delves beyond the crime scene to explore the psychological complexities of both perpetrators and investigators, creating a multi-layered thriller that examines the toll of pursuing justice at all costs.
The dual narrative explores Kay Scarpetta’s (Kidman) journey from her beginnings as a Chief Medical Examiner in the late ’90s to her present-day return to her hometown, where she resumes her former position while investigating a grisly murder. As Scarpetta pursues justice, she must navigate complicated relationships, including the fraught dynamic with her sister Dorothy Farinelli (Jamie Lee Curtis), confront long-held professional and personal grudges, and face secrets that threaten to unravel everything she’s built.

In addition to Kidman and Curtis, Scarpetta stars Emmy winner as Detective “Pete Marino,” with Emmy nominee Simon Baker as FBI profiler “Benton Wesley” and Oscar winner Ariana DeBose as Kay’s tech-savvy niece “Lucy Watson.” The series’ dual timeline is completed by Rosy McEwen (Blue Jean), Amanda Righetti (The Mentalist), Jake Cannavale (The Offer), and Hunter Parrish (Weeds), who portray the past versions of Kidman, Curtis, Cannavale, and Baker’s characters, respectively.
Developed and written for television Liz Sarnoff, Scarpetta is executive produced by Kidman and Per Saari through Blossom Films, Curtis through Comet Pictures, writer and showrunner Sarnoff through Sarnoff TV, author Cornwell through P & S Projects, as well as Jason Blum, Jeremy Gold, Chris Dickie, and Chris McCumber through Blumhouse Television. David Gordon Green directed five episodes and also serves as executive producer alongside Amy Sayres. The series is produced by Amazon MGM Studios and Blumhouse Television in association with Blossom Films, Comet Pictures, and P&S Projects.
Scarpetta premieres March 11 exclusive on Prime Video in more than 240 countries and territories worldwide.
